Comparalve Study of Octreotide and Loperamide in the Treatmentof 5-Fluorouracial-induced Diarrhea

Shimin Wen

Open publisher page 0 citations

Abstract

Objective:To observe the complete response rate of diarrhea and median time of response to octreotide and loperamide in 5-Fluorouracial-induced diarrhea.Method:30 cases patients with 5-Fluorouracial-induced diarrhea are divided into octreotide group(OCT group 14) and loperamide group(LOP group 16)respectively.Result:The complete response rate of diarrhea is 78.57% (11/14) in OCT group and 43.75% (7/16) in LOP group.There was satatistically significant difference beaween these twe groups(P0.05),The midian time of complete response was 3 days in OCT group and 6.5 days in LOP group.Conclusion:Octveotide was more effect than loperamide in 5- Fluorouracial-induced diarrhea,and may improve diarrhea in shirt period.
